Title :
Data mining in engineering design: a case study

Abstract :
In the paper, a prediction problem encountered in engineering design is considered. The problem is solved with a data mining approach. The first of the two algorithms presented in the paper generates a solution, while the second algorithm validates this solution. Only confirmed solutions are accepted
